Selective formation of ethanol from methanol, hydrogen and carbon monoxide 원문보기

IPC분류정보
국가/구분 United States(US) Patent 등록
국제특허분류(IPC7판)
  • C07C-029/00
출원번호 US-0863792 (1977-12-23)
발명자 / 주소
  • Pretzer Wayne R. (Oakmont Borough PA) Kobylinski Thaddeus P. (Gibsonia PA) Bozik John E. (Plum Borough PA)
출원인 / 주소
  • Gulf Research & Development Company (Pittsburgh PA 02)
인용정보 피인용 횟수 : 72  인용 특허 : 0

초록

A process for the selective formation of ethanol which comprises contacting methanol, hydrogen and carbon monoxide with a catalyst system comprising cobalt acetylacetonate, a tertiary organo Group V A compound of the periodic Table, a first promoter comprising an iodine compound and a second promote
